Did anybody had this issue before? I just replace my factory 18's to factory 19's and it doesn't show anything on my monitor so I went to the Nissan dealer to get my Tire pressure relearned so I got it done but now on my monitor the both of front PSI shows but the rear doesn't. I called the dealer and they told me it's still learning so it might take a little time or they asked me did I drove more than 30 miles? and yes I did drove more than 30 miles. did anyone else had this issue??

I have not had this issue (after replaced the tire). But, what I heard is: you need to drive at least 20 min. at a time while maintain speed over 20 (maybe 25) mph. If you did the 30 miles in stop & go traffic, that will not do the trick.

I would just hop on the highway and drive for 20 min. if you have not done it yet. Good luck!

The manual says 10 minutes above 25mph. I did that and it worked perfectly.

The trick, as M45Runner said, is not to drop below 25mph. If you do the timer starts over and you have to go ten more minutes.
